Analysis

Myanmar recorded 189,170 for number of malaria cases treated with any first  line tx courses in 2024. That is the highest value across all 7 years on record.

The figure is up 348.4% on the previous year and up 256.5% over ten years.

That places Myanmar 35th out of 75 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

Number of malaria cases treated with any first  line tx courses in Myanmar, year by year

Annual values for Number of malaria cases treated with any first  line tx courses (including artemisinin-based combination therapies (ACTs)) in Myanmar, 2018 to 2024.
Year Value Change
2018 53,056
2019 53,003 -0.1%
2020 15,572 -70.6%
2021 15,127 -2.9%
2022 30,573 +102.1%
2023 42,188 +38.0%
2024 189,170 +348.4%
